Overlooking the … WebClamping force is the amount of force that is applied to a joint to hold the two pieces together. The Clamping Force Formula is based on the torque applied to the bolt, friction of the bolt contact, and diameter of the bolt. The formula is F=T/K∗D. where F is the clamping force, T is the torque applied to the bolt, K is the friction of the ... btec textbooks https://oakwoodfsg.com

WebFeb 15, 2008 · 1) Clamp force on the joint in question. 2) Friction. This is why torque specs varying depending on lubricant. Moly lube vs. oil vs dry. In the case of a bolt. Friction btw the bolt threads and hole threads and friction btw the bolt head, washer, and (in this case) manifold. In the case of a stud and nut.
